Imagine having the courage to stand up against a genocide. In this episode of 'Steps to Sobriety', host Stephan Neff sits down with Dr. Mukesh Kapila, a man whose life story is as inspiring as it is harrowing. With a background in global health, humanitarian affairs, and human rights, Dr. Kapila has dedicated his life to making the world a better place. From his early days in India and England to his impactful work in Sudan, Dr.
Kapila's journey is a testament to the power of resilience and moral courage. Dr. Kapila's decision to blow the whistle on the Darfur genocide is at the heart of this episode. He takes listeners through the intense moral dilemmas he faced and the profound personal impact of his actions. His story isn't just about the horrors he witnessed; it's also about the strength it takes to speak out when it's easier to stay silent.
The episode dives deep into the complexities of being a whistleblower, shedding light on both the challenges and the necessity of taking a stand against injustice. For anyone grappling with their own battles or looking for a dose of inspiration, Dr. Kapila's narrative offers valuable lessons on the importance of personal choices in the face of adversity.
